Bicycle and Pedestrian Initiatives Multimodal System Plan: Framework developed in 2013 to provide common language and best practices for localities to use while planning for multimodal corridors and places. PWC will become the 2 nd jurisdiction in Virginia to develop a Multimodal System Plan, which will improve the ability to implement multimodal streets in urban parts of the county.
